The purpose of this study was to review the systematic review of behavioral economics studies in sport industry, how to determine their effects and how they work, to summarize all the researches and identify the strengths and weaknesses of the research carried out, as well as to provide Solutions for future studies.(Rosdiana Sijabat, ۲۰۱۸)The present study was conducted using a systematic or systematic review. A manual search was also made by examining the resources of all relevant subject-related documents from the period of ۲۰۰۰ to ۲۰۲۱ using the targeted keywords.. Therefore, the documents with the criteria for entering the study were selected and examined. At the end of the research, the researcher analyzed the selected documentation based on the analysis of qualitative content with obvious content. (Satu Elo & Helvi Kynga¨s, ۲۰۰۷)A total of ۱۵۰ studies were conducted for systematic review. After removing duplicates and screening.Finally, ۴۳ studies were selected and analyzed. About twenty studies examined the behavioral economics is the use of psychology and sociology in economic analysis, thirteen studies on the behavioral economics is a discipline that analyzes individual decision-making, and ten studies examined the behavioral economics in public policy.According to a systematic review of studies, this strength of behavioral economics has enabled the approach to be widely applied in both the public and private sectors. In the public sector, for example, governments have been able to use behavioral economics approaches to formulate public policy and influence the behaviors of their citizens. In the private sector, meanwhile, a bounty of empirical evidence indicates that behavioral economics has been used by companies to determine the most appropriate strategies for influencing consumers decisions to purchase certain products
